6.
Set the name for each line of the home page light display. These may be in any language.
7.
The light table of the home page supports a total of 7 data columns. The first column is always
the current “live” measurement data. Additonal columns hold reference measurements. Live
data is copied to the reference measurement column by clicking on the header of the column on
the home page. Define a name for each of the data columns, The first column is always labeled
LIVE.
8.
The right side of this configuration screen allows reference column names to be defined for the
SPL measurement. These behave the same as the light reference measurements described in
the previous step. Up to 14 SPL reference columns may be defined.
9.
The LSS-100P determines the highest SPL it measured from midnight local time to midnight local
time. The highest value is logged each night at midnight. You can set a limit for the maximum
SPL on this page. If this value is exceeded, the maximum SPL of the day will be shown in red on
the log.
10.
The LSS-100P makes out of tolerance readings available to the USL Ethernet Device Discoverer
(see
http://ftp.uslinc.com/?dir=ftp/Products/EthernetDeviceDiscoverer
). Ethernet Device
Discoverer “discovers” USL products on the network. In addition, it shows status messages from
each device. If Etherernet Discoverer Log Review Days is set to 7 (as shown in figure 7), Ethernet
Device Discoverer will display any out of tolerance readings logged in the past 7 days.
11.
Once this data has been entered, click the “Save User Data” button to save the settings to the
LSS-100P.
